Phloroglucinol (CAS: 108-73-6) is a high-purity organic compound, typically appearing as a white crystalline powder with a minimum assay of 98.0%. Its primary value lies in its diverse applications as a laboratory reagent and a crucial intermediate in organic synthesis. This compound is widely recognized for its role in analytical testing, particularly for the identification of lignin in paper and the detection of various organic compounds like vanillin and aldehydes.

Key Applications
Lignin Detection
Phloroglucinol is crucial for the detection of lignin, particularly in paper products, aiding in material identification and quality control.
Dye and Pigment Industry
It functions as a coupling agent in the synthesis of certain dyes, contributing to the color fastness and brilliance of the final products.
Organic Synthesis
As a valuable intermediate, Phloroglucinol is utilized in various organic synthesis pathways for creating complex molecules.
Analytical Reagent
In laboratories, it serves as a general analytical reagent for testing vanillin, sugars, and aldehydes, supporting numerous research endeavors.
